Explore the bait shops in Poway, California. Find live bait, tackle, and fishing gear near you.
Category: Fishing store
Address: 13132 Poway Rd Suite B, Poway, CA 92064
Phone: +1 858-883-4272
SluggFishing Bait and Tackle Shop offers the following bait types: Frozen Bait.
SluggFishing Bait and Tackle Shop is located at 13132 Poway Rd Suite B, Poway, CA 92064.